Output 1576c814d8e0daa07663ee73a91bad57da77f9584c97586fc888c435a4e3cd25:0

value
10858214864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9547254cc7eb1c26a9b11f971fb5fce7b49269c0 OP_EQUALVERIFY OP_CHECKSIG
address
1EcJusdC3jpvujH6QQFX6ZdH54dg9fQMbi
transaction
1576c814d8e0daa07663ee73a91bad57da77f9584c97586fc888c435a4e3cd25
spent
true